THE STORY OF EJIRU

images.jpeg
Image Source

I will like to tell you about the story of young beautiful girl that hail from Ekaki village in one small Africa country her name was Ejiru.

Born into the five of six and happen to be the last born being also the era of farming. During that time woman are more consider to be a good house wife property and a helping mate in the farm work.

As a young lady Ejiru had a strong passion to lead and become a great person in life not just a mere house wife. This kind of passion sound odd in that time as many people wonder what the future hold for a girl that have chosen this pathway.

Criticism began to flow in as many people could not withstand such passion and determination from a girl.

Just like Thomas A. Edison said in one of his statement

Our greatest weakness lies in giving up. The most certain way to succeed is always to try just one more time.
— Thomas A. Edison source

In the face of many challenges and criticism Ejiru made up her mind that she will not give up on her dream. So she continues to try her best and she was determine to go to school and become a lawyer although education was not common at that time. After talking at length with her father and with the influence of her mom she enrolled into a primary and secondary school in the neighboring village. As time roll by she finished her secondary school and with the help of her uncle, she was able to make it to university level and eventually become the first female lawyer in her village.
